The Texas Department of Public Safety (DPS) announced it is investigating links between the far-left group Antifa and violence and looting at protests that erupted during protests sparked by the death of George Floyd.

The agency’s director, Steven McGraw, made the announcement Tuesday while noting the May 31 raid on a Target in Austin, the state capital. He said Antifa coordinated the looting over the Internet.
